This thread is dumb. And why are people against boosting with boots. I had so many injuries from feet half coming out with foot pads. And looping with boots feel way better on the landings.
I remember having a full day of loops, then having to come because my feet were a little sore. Took my feet out on my boots then fell over in pain. Boots just keep everything much tight and secure.

Looping sessions... I always wished I was in boots, ya right above I reckon even with all the stupid red thumbs. More connection to the board, can hold lots of power and load the lines better! Can pull earlier, get yanked more knowing that if you come in hot, the speed and power is going to be absorbed better.

But then I couldn't do board offs in the same session so pads and straps it is...

depends on what you are doing I think.
